Chicago Blackhawks Announce Opening Night Pregame Festivities

The Chicago Blackhawks will host their home opener on Sunday night against the Toronto Maple Leafs, and fans are encouraged to visit the United Center for all the festivities before the game.

The Blackhawks, as has become tradition over the last decade, will hold a Red Carpet entrance for players and coaches that will be free and open to the public.

Fans will also be able to visit the new offerings inside the United Center Atrium, which will feature new food and beverage options and the expanded Madhouse Team Store.

All United Center parking lots are currently open, and fans do not need to have a ticket to attend the red carpet ceremony.

Inside the United Center, the Blackhawks are encouraging fans to take photos in front of “Hockey New Year” signs near the LED walls outside of sections 101 and 111, and are also encouraging fans to be in their seats by 5:30 p.m. for their tribute to Stan Mikita, who passed away earlier this year.
